Navigating logistical complexities in diverse terrains

Navigating logistical complexities in diverse terrains poses significant challenges for military medical supply chains. Varied environments such as mountains, jungles, deserts, and urban settings demand tailored logistical approaches. These terrains can impede transportation routes, complicate access, and increase transit times.

Effective management requires detailed terrain analysis and strategic planning to identify optimal routes and transportation modes. Reliance on land, air, and water transport must be flexible and adaptable to changing conditions, often necessitating innovative solutions like off-road vehicles or aerial delivery methods.

Maintaining supply chain efficiency in such environments also demands real-time tracking technology and contingency planning. This ensures that medical supplies reach their destination despite obstacles or delays created by the terrain. Addressing these logistical complexities is vital for sustaining operational readiness and delivering timely medical support in military operations.

Inventory management and forecasting techniques

Effective inventory management and forecasting techniques are vital for maintaining the readiness of military medical supplies. These techniques ensure that critical equipment and pharmaceuticals are available when needed, without overstocking or excess waste.

Key practices include real-time inventory monitoring systems, automated tracking, and standardized inventory procedures. These facilitate accurate stock level assessments and quick response to fluctuating demand.

Forecasting methods such as historical data analysis, trend analysis, and predictive modeling are employed to anticipate future needs. This enables military logistics teams to adjust procurement and distribution strategies proactively, minimizing shortages during emergencies.

A structured approach often involves:

  1. Regular data collection on usage patterns.
  2. Application of statistical tools to predict demand surges.
  3. Coordinated replenishment cycles aligned with operational planning.

By integrating these inventory management and forecasting techniques, military medical supply chains enhance operational efficiency and resilience, especially in unpredictable or complex deployment environments.

Standards and certifications relevant to military needs

Standards and certifications are vital components of military medical supply chain management, ensuring that supplies meet rigorous safety and quality requirements. They serve as benchmarks for consistent performance and reliability across all stages of the supply process.

Military medical supplies are required to comply with both international and specific military standards, such as ISO 13485 for medical devices, which ensures quality management systems, and the FDA regulations for pharmaceuticals. Compliance with these standards guarantees that products are safe, effective, and manufactured under controlled conditions suitable for military use.

Certifications like the NATO Stock Number (NSN) facilitate standardized procurement and logistics, enabling interoperability among allied forces. Additionally, military-specific standards may mandate adherence to stringent environmental and durability criteria, addressing unique operational conditions. Maintaining compliance with these standards and certifications is crucial for streamlining procurement, reducing risks, and ensuring that medical supplies meet the high demands of military operations.

Case Studies of Successful Military Medical Supply Chain Strategies

Real-world examples of military medical supply chain strategies demonstrate the effectiveness of integrated planning and technological innovation. One notable example is the U.S. Department of Defense’s use of centralized data systems to monitor inventory levels and predict future needs, enabling rapid response to unexpected demand surges. This approach significantly reduces delays and shortages during crisis situations.

Another example is the integration of pre-positioned medical supplies in strategic locations worldwide. This strategy enhances logistical efficiency and ensures critical medical resources are readily accessible, even in remote or hostile terrains. The United States military’s use of this method has proven effective in reducing transit times and maintaining medical readiness during deployments.

A further case involves collaboration with commercial logistics providers to leverage advanced transportation networks. This partnership facilitates swift distribution of medical supplies across varied terrains, ensuring supply chain continuity during military operations. Such multi-faceted strategies showcase how blending technology, strategic planning, and partnerships optimize military medical supply chains in complex environments.
